Belt Color Styles and Their Definitions



As you proceed through the belt degrees in Taekwondo, each color represents a details meaning and represents your development in the fighting style.

The white belt, which is the starting factor for all novices, signifies purity and innocence.

As will martial arts build muscle move on to the yellow belt, it indicates the earth from which a plant sprouts and takes root.

The green belt stands for development and the advancement of your skills.

The blue belt symbolizes the skies, where your potential as a Taekwondo expert is infinite.

The red belt stands for danger and care, reminding you to use your abilities properly.

Lastly, the black belt represents mastery and proficiency, indicating your journey in the direction of becoming a true Taekwondo master.

Each belt shade holds its very own distinct definition, reflecting your progression and dedication in this ancient martial art.
